首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JS如何实现全部复选框和不全选复选框

复选框是一个很常见的操作,复选框可以执行多项选择的一种控件,有时,为了方便用户选中所有的复选框,网页界面 会提供一个选中所有复选框的功能,怎么实现一个复选框全部被选中的效果呢 示例效果 allcheckbox 原生Js...实现全选的效果,复选框是否被,是由它的checked属性决定的,因此,实现本例效果的关键就是找到所有对应的复选框,然后将其它的checked属性设置为true或false实现全选或全不 如下实现一个简易的全选功能...lang="scss" scoped> .wrap { text-align: center; margin:20px 0 20px 0; } 总结 实现全选与全不在一些后台业务管理系统里面...,是一个很常见基础的业务实现 全选与全不的复选框是否被,是由它的checked属性决定的,checked的属性值若为true那么状态为选中,若为false那么不选中 前端UI显示,与具体要向后端传入的值

6.3K60
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    python3 selenium + f

    一、 分析: 抓取动态页面js加载的人民日报里面的新闻详情 https://wap.peopleapp.com/news/1 先打开,然后查看网页源码,发现是一堆js,并没有具体的每个新闻的url详情...,于是第一反应,肯定是js动态加载拼接的url。...但这个抓到的url只加载了10条,我于是想改改里面的 show_num值,发现请求失败,仔细看这个url,有个securitykey 这个应该是js根据具体算法算出来的,看了一下那个拼接成url的js,...1.7.设置火狐浏览器去连接fiddler代理 找到网络设置,打开,点击手动代理配置,填写ip,端口,”为所有协议使用相同的代理服务器” ? ?...while True: #翻页脚本 browser.execute_script('window.scrollTo(0, document.body.scrollHeight)') #翻页,暂停1秒

    98730

    Autumn 主题更新到 3.0,专业版开启预售预售

    后台增加了一个选项,可将所有列表文章都改成“特色”文章显示样式。 增加了文章相关推荐模块,可以在文章内容底部查看。...修复了ajax翻页,文章重复显示的bug。 已经安装的同学,直接在后台点击更新即可,如果还没有安装的同学,点击这里下载主题文件,自己通过FTP覆盖上传。...特别注意:如果有使用cdn加速,或者有缓存js和css,请自行更新缓存。 Autumn-Pro 专业版开启预售 实话实说,就是因为穷,所以我们决定推出 Autumn主题 Pro版本。...原价500元,现在预售价格是200元,在线购买(点击阅读原文),等待正式发布,即可到下载,预计八月中旬正式上线。

    45910

    begin主题使用说明(详解教程)

    杂志布局设置 主题默认为博客布局,登录WP后台→外观→主题选项→首页设置→首页布局选择,“CMS布局”,然后打开CMS设置选项卡页,看上去有些繁杂,其实需要设置的基本就三项: 是否显示某个模块 输入分类...其中: 公告,在主题选项中显示,只显示在首页固定的导航菜单下。...进入主题选项---辅助功能,启用百度分享即可。 备用代码 键盘翻页 主题支持在分类归档页面,用键盘左右方向键翻页,可以跳过滚动加载文章,直接进入下页,包括博客布局的首页。...设置时只“优化 HTML 代码和优化 CSS 代码”,其它默认即可。 绝对不能“优化 JavaScript 代码”否则将造成主题部分功能不可用,切记!...开启留言头像延迟加载,多说方式加载头像,只会显示设置的默认头像,并且评论ajax分页翻页将不显示头像,酌情开启。 自定页面宽度,只可适当加宽或减小,否则有些位置缩略尺寸小会显示异常。

    4.7K40

    【学习笔记】解决layui的table分页没有checkbox记忆功能!!!

    引言 layui是一款采用自身模块规范编写的前端 UI 框架,遵循原生 HTML/CSS/JS 的书写与组织形式,门槛极低,拿来即用。其外在极简,非常适合界面的快速开发。...console.log(layui.data('checked')); }); 问题 由于layui没有自己的记忆功能,所以需要自己来实现,我们先来看看layui给我们checkbox生成的代码吧 未生成的代码...layui-form-checkbox" lay-skin="primary"> 已生成的代码...console.log(item); }); 那么这个时候问题就出来了,每个checkbox都是一对一对的一模一样的,最主要行的索引data-index是一样的,只是在不同table中,这个时候我们只需要根据临时的数据保存到缓存中...然后翻页的时候再根据循环缓存数据与当前页的数据一个个匹配,匹配成功之后,将将当前的页的索引拿到,然后拼接成$('.layui-table tr[data-index=' + i + '] input[type

    5.7K20

    BlackHat USA 2020 资料爬虫最佳姿势与打包下载

    通过Chrome商店安装好Web Scraper,在其“开发者工具”里面可以看到: 点击“Create new sitemap”,设置下任务的名称,以及爬虫的起始页,这里就取BlackHat的议题列表地址...注意:这里必须“Multiple”,否则无法选上所有议题链接: 点击创建的“session”进入议题详情页面,即二级页面: 接下来就要获取PDF下载地址了,这里包括slide和paper两个下载地址...此处“Type”“Link”而不是“Element click”去模拟点击下载,是因为chrome里面点击pdf链接会直接打开,所以获取链接地址再用命令行去下载: 这里“Parent Selectors...”就是父页面中我们设置的对应id,层级关系相当于爬虫进入下一页再找目标元素一样,用它我们也可以实现翻页效果(翻页经常在get参数中设置,所以有时可以直接在起始URL中设置页参数范围,比如http://test.com

    89720

    不用代码,10分钟采集58同城二手车数据信息

    第三步:提取目标信息 1、将鼠标移到标题上,待选择的标题变成蓝色,点击鼠标,得到如下图对话框,选择“抓取这个元素的文本” ?...第四步:设置翻页和AJAX设置 1、将鼠标移到页面底端的翻页处,把鼠标放在“下一页”上,变成蓝色,即可点击选中: ?...2、在弹出的对话框中选择“循环点击下一页”即可建立好翻页,可以将后面几页的信息自动选中。 ?...3、然后鼠标选中左边规则中的“点击翻页”,在左边的高级选项中点开下拉页面,在“AJax加载”一项中AJax加载数据,超时2秒。 ?...2、采集完成,会跳出提示,选择“导出数据”选择“合适的导出方式”,将采集好的数据导出这里我们选择excel作为导出为格式,数据导出如下图 ?

    1.3K80

    树莓派挂载固态硬盘安装系统并入门设置 - 史上最详细版(原创)

    设置树莓派VNC的分辨率 如果不设置树莓派VNC的分辨率,会导致黑屏 sudo raspi-config 博主喜欢大分辨率,就选择了 1920*1080 设置好随手更新一下系统,就OK了 树莓派设置中文界面和时间区域...ttf-wqy-zenhei 树莓派设置显示中文 sudo raspi-config 依次选择 Localisation Options --> Locale 操作提示:按空格键在前面打勾或去掉(...星号=),PageUp PageDown快速翻页,Tab键跳到OK按钮上 去掉en_GB.UTF-8 UTF-8, 勾上:“en_US.UTF-8 UTF-8”、“zh_CN.UTF-8 UTF-8”...、“zh_CN.GBK GBK” 操作提示:按空格键在前面打勾或去掉(星号=),PageUp PageDown快速翻页,Tab键跳到OK按钮上 去掉en_GB.UTF-8 UTF-8, 勾上:“en_US.UTF...-8 UTF-8”、“zh_CN.UTF-8 UTF-8”、“zh_CN.GBK GBK” 下一屏幕默认语言 “zh_CN.UTF-8” 树莓派安装中文输入法 sudo apt-get -y install

    5.4K20

    Salesforce LWC学习(三十三) lightning-datatable 翻页bug处理

    点击翻页以后,两个问题如下: 1)第二页的第五条同样的默认了,尽管这个时候我们如果使用event.detail.selectedRows去获取选中的选项,第二页是没有在这里的,但是UI撒谎了,这个是一个很严重的...其实我也不太清楚是什么原因,datatable官方的设计中也没有翻页的demo,大部分都是loadMore当页增加数据场景,所以可能针对每页的index处选中效果有某个隐藏的bug。...优化的方案如下所示: myAccountList.js新增一个方法 @api handleTableScrollTop() { this.template.querySelector('div...').scrollTop = 0; } accountListContainer.js修改一下 setPagination方法。...总结:篇中代码实现了通过 lightning-datatable翻页效果以及针对两个潜在的bug的修复。偏中有错误欢迎指出,有不懂欢迎留言。有更好方式欢迎交流。

    97331

    【鸿蒙 HarmonyOS】HarmonyOS 开发环境搭建 ( Node.js 安装 )

    文章目录 一、下载 Node.js® 安装包 二、安装 Node.js 三、验证 Node.js 鸿蒙 HarmonyOS 开发环境 DevEco Studio 安装 , 参考博客 : 【鸿蒙 HarmonyOS...】HarmonyOS 开发环境搭建 ( 下载 | 安装 | 启动 | 支持的设备与开发语言 ) 【鸿蒙 HarmonyOS】HarmonyOS 开发环境搭建 ( Node.js 安装 ) 一、下载 Node.js...node-v14.15.3-x64.msi ; 同意许可协议 : 选择安装位置 : 选择安装组件 : 都选上 ; 选择 Native Modules 工具 : 这里可以不该选项 ,...之后 , 会在 Node.js 安装完毕 , 弹出安装 Python 和 Visual Studio 编译工具的窗口 ; 开始安装 : 等待安装结束 ; 安装完成 ; 安装 Python...和 Visual Studio 编译工具 , 这是在之前 选择 Native Modules 工具 时 , 了选项导致 , 可以不安装 , 这里先关闭该命令窗口 ; 三、验证 Node.js --

    2.1K11

    现代 Web 开发者问卷调查报告

    仍然有接近一半的开发者了 ES5,由于问题设计的缺陷,从数据无法挖掘到很直观的原因,但能看到一些可能相关的数据: 没 ES5 的开发者,在「UI 技术」问题中 Vue 的比例降低了(从 65.2%...降到 58.23%) 没 ES5 的开发者,在「UI 技术」问题中 Vanilla JS 的比例降低了(从 11.11% 降到 7.62%) 在非 JS 语言中,Python、Go、Rust...了这些非 JS 语言的开发者,在其他问题中纯前端 CSS 技术(Less、PostCSS、styled-components)、React、SSR 的比例没有明显下降(分别是:从 82% 降到...如果在「工程技术」问题里了 Next.js / Umi / CRA, React 的比例更是提高到接近 100%( Vue 的比例是 60.91%),这一定程度上体现了 Dan Abramov...在了 ES5 的开发者中, Vanilla JS(相当于 jQuery 吧)的比例从 11.11% 提高到 15.14%(反过来,了 Vanilla JS 的开发者, ES5 的比例同样从

    1.5K40

    JavaScript代码混淆加密

    禁用控制台调试(开启无法通过控制台进行代码调试)禁止代码格式化(开启后代码在格式化将无法正常运行,如果开启了此配置导致代码无法运行请查看底部说明进行排除 )混淆更改变量名、函数名(提交的代码中的函数名变量名...,多个子域名支持统一配置、支持前端通配符,如 *.safekodo.com名称保留字:当了混淆变量函数名,对于不想被混淆的变量名、函数名可在此处添加运行时间锁定:运行时间锁定,锁定后代码仅在指定时间段内可以运行...如果该选项默认为一年动态加密### 动态加密动态加密仅适用于web端js加密,需要上传一个js文件,加密获得一个以script方式引入的script标签您可直接在项目中粘贴引用,这样每次访问该网站时...script标签引入的js都将是不同的且为加密js文件,从而达到动态加密的效果图片图片动态加密运行示例图片参数介绍与JavaScript代码加密 不同的是 高级配置中 引用方式可选 https ||...首先需要排除的是配置项中是否了“混淆更改变量名、函数名”。如果了此配置,可尝试取消。或在“名称保留字”配置中添加。也可以修改未加密的js代码,将该方法或者变量定义为全局的。

    2.3K41
    领券